Noun

pertaining (plural pertainings)

  1. Something that pertains; an appurtenance.
    • 1869, Horace Bushnell, Women's suffrage: the reform against nature, page 90:
      When, I say, these things are duly considered as pertainings of a woman's lot, we might almost justify them in a riot against natural sexhood itself, if there were any thing to be gained by it.
